What is MEP in construction?

MEP stands for mechanical, electrical, and plumbing, the three building systems trades in commercial construction. Mechanical covers HVAC (heating, ventilation, and air conditioning), electrical covers power, lighting, and low voltage systems, and plumbing covers domestic water, sanitary, storm, and gas piping. The work is designed by specialty engineers, installed by licensed subcontractors, and typically represents one of the largest cost blocks in a commercial project budget.

Definition

On a commercial drawing set, MEP shows up as the M, E, and P sheet series, with the specs living in CSI MasterFormat Divisions 21 through 28 (plumbing in Division 22, HVAC in Division 23, electrical in Division 26). General contractors rarely self-perform this work. Licensed mechanical, electrical, and plumbing subcontractors bid and install it, with MEP consulting engineers producing the design on plan-and-spec jobs. For an estimator, MEP matters for two reasons: it is a huge share of cost, and it is where trade scopes collide. The classic new-estimator mistakes are treating MEP as one number instead of three separate subcontracts, assuming fire protection is included when it usually bids as its own trade, and missing interface gaps such as who wires the rooftop units, who furnishes starters and disconnects, and who carries housekeeping pads and roof curbs. MEP is also the center of gravity for BIM coordination, since duct, pipe, conduit, and sprinkler mains all fight for the same ceiling space above the corridors.

How it is measured

There is no single MEP unit; each trade quantifies differently. Plumbing counts fixtures each (EA) and runs pipe in linear feet (LF) by diameter and material. Mechanical counts equipment each, prices ductwork by the pound (lb) of sheet metal or square feet (SF) of duct surface, runs hydronic and refrigerant pipe in LF, and sizes systems in tons of cooling and CFM of airflow. Electrical counts fixtures and devices each, runs conduit and wire in LF, and sizes the service in amps. The quantities live on the M, E, and P sheets and their schedules: equipment schedules, plumbing fixture schedules, panel schedules, and riser diagrams. At concept stage, estimators apply dollars per SF by system or a percentage of total construction cost, then replace those plugs with subcontractor bids as design firms up.

Worked example

Worked example

Take an illustrative 50,000 SF office building at a total construction cost of $400 per SF, or $20.0 million. Carry mechanical at $52 per SF, electrical at $46 per SF, and plumbing at $22 per SF. Combined that is $120 per SF: $120 x 50,000 SF = $6.0 million, and $6.0 million divided by $20.0 million = 30 percent of the budget sitting in three subcontracts. Now the coordination side. If congested ceiling space drives rework equal to just 2 percent of MEP value, that is 0.02 x $6,000,000 = $120,000 of exposure before any schedule damage, which is why an illustrative $50,000 spent on BIM coordination across these trades pays for itself well before the rework hits. Note the leverage at concept stage too: moving your MEP allowance by one point of project cost is 0.01 x $20.0 million = $200,000.

MEP: frequently asked questions

Does MEP include fire protection?+

Not automatically. Fire suppression is its own CSI division (Division 21) and usually bids as a separate trade through a sprinkler contractor, which is why you will see MEPF or MEP/FP on projects that group it in. On bid day, confirm whether fire protection has its own column on the bid tab, because assuming it is buried in the mechanical number is a classic scope gap.

What is the difference between MEP and HVAC?+

HVAC is one piece of the M in MEP. On commercial work the mechanical scope is mostly heating, ventilation, and air conditioning (equipment, ductwork, hydronic piping, and controls), while MEP also covers the electrical and plumbing trades. Saying MEP when you mean only the mechanical package will muddy sub coverage lists, so name the trade you actually need.

What percentage of a construction budget is MEP?+

It depends heavily on building type, so treat any single number as a planning figure only. As an illustrative rule of thumb in US commercial work, ordinary office and retail buildings often carry roughly 25 to 35 percent of construction cost in combined MEP, while system-heavy buildings such as hospitals, labs, and data centers can run well above 40 percent. Reconcile the plug against actual subcontractor budgets as design develops.
